Title :
The development of super high definition image storage system
Author :
Murakami, Tokumichi ; Ohira, Hideo ; Tanno, Okikazu ; Suzuki, Ryuuta ; Wada, Minoru ; Saito, Taku ; Ogura, Koji ; Asai, Kohtaro
Author_Institution :
Mitsubishi Electric Corp., Kamakura, Japan
Abstract :
A super-high-definition (SHD) image storage system was developed for next-generation visual communication. This system with a high-speed signal processing function is designed to display a 2048 by 2048 pixel (non-interlaced 60 frames per second) real-time motion color picture of maximum 16-s interval. The requirements for this system and the specification are discussed, and the hardware architecture of the high-resolution memory unit, D/A converter unit, DMA controller, address generator, and high-speed data buses are introduced in detail. This system can be utilized for the coding quality evaluation for SHD images which provide resolution equivalent to 35-mm film
